Pontiac, Il vs Mangochi Climate & Distance Between

Malawi flag
  • The distance between Pontiac, Il, Usa and Mangochi, Malawi is approximately 13,910 km or 8,644 mi.
  • To reach Pontiac, Il in this distance one would set out from Mangochi bearing 310.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Pontiac, Il bearing 258° or WSW .
  • Pontiac,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Mangochi has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Pontiac,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Mangochi is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 14.1 °C (25.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 22.6 °C (40.7°F) more in Pontiac, Il.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 50.6 mm (2 in) more which is equivalent to 50.6 l/m² (1.24 US gal/ft²) or 506,000 l/ha (54,095 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22.2° lower in Pontiac, Il than in Mangochi.
